This striking Downtown LA lounge and eatery boasts zen-like design details and floor to ceiling windows that afford jaw-dropping views of an adjacent swimming pool and the Downtown skyline. Chef Kris Morningstar, formerly of Patina and Meson G, spoke with Shira Lazar to preview Blue Velvet’s unconventional spin on modern American favorites.
A 17-foot communal table and open fire pits on the restaurant’s rooftop garden add to the gather-round vibe at Blue Velvet. Just don’t expect to be roasting your own marshmallows. The lounge menu is served until 2 AM offering swank campfire snacks like blue cheese beignets and a warm crab dip with leeks. And, trust us, Dennis Hopper would approve.
